    Ateneo de Manila University is one of the top 4 universities in the Philippines in teems of academic excellence, located in Katipunan, Quezon City, accessible along C5 Road and situated beside Miriam College. At the interior of the compound, it has a thoroughfare with large grassy park, several buildings each housing with different academic fields, and since the area was huge, it can be accessible by riding an e-Jeep. Walking around can be optional. They have several football or soccer fields for playing or, as a training ground, research facility, a hilly forested area, and several dormitories. The buildings were highly maintained, making it stylish.

    To understand the soul of the Ateneo de Manila University, what shaped it and where it came here, where it is going and where it can you, it is essential to understand its motto, Lux in Domino, or "Light in the Lord." To be "light in the Lord" in all fullness demands moving insistently and deliberately towards God as the center of a person's life, identifying the issues that such a centering poses, and then moving out to the world to find ever new ways of constructing the edifice, cultivating the garden, painting the masterpiece, that God is unfolding in one's life. It is a call to be that light of the Lord in the world. The Ateneo de Manila University celebrates its 145th anniversary and 145 years of the return of Jesuit Education to the Philippines on December 10, 2004.
